Extracted from the Purcell Society Dramatic Works Edition (NOV950122), this dramatic duet is for Alto and Bass voices. Part of Purcell's incidental music to Thomas D'Urfey's play A Comical History of Don Quixote, (written 1694).

The first complete volume of Henry Purcell's Catches to appear in Purcell Society Edition since 1922. The new edition lays particular emphasis on accuracy and performance and includes a comprehensive commentary. Cloth edition available: NOV151103-01.

This composition is based on the march from Henry Purcell's Music for the funeral of Queen Mary II, a work written in 1694. In this fantasia, various movements flow from one to the next following the main theme: these movements not only elaborate on the theme, but also contrast with it. At times, the thematic material diverges so much, that the work acquires a character of its own: however, the composer often refers back to fragments of the theme. (Grade 3.5) Dur: 11:30 (De Haske).

Poul Ruders' Prologue To Dido And Aenas by Henry Purcell (2011). Text by Nahum Tate.
Commissioned by The Danish National Vocal Ensemble / DR
Scored for Mixed Choir (SATB), String Quartet, Percussion, Theorbe and Harpsichord.Vocal score available: WH31460CParts available: WH31460A
